Paradigm releases Alloy v0.1, a code library for interacting with Ethereum
Paradigm has launched Alloy v0.1, a code library for interacting with Ethereum. Alloy is a complete rewrite of the low-level building blocks required to interact with EVM blockchains, from RPC types to ABI encoders and raw types, intended to replace ethers-rs. Alloy v0.1 includes all utilities needed for interaction with EVM-based blockchains, numerous API improvements and new features. As part of this release, Paradigm will officially cease maintenance of ethers-rs and encourages everyone to migrate to Alloy.
